강의

멘토링

커뮤니티

Cộng đồng Hỏi & Đáp của Inflearn

Hình ảnh hồ sơ của sss9524560292
sss9524560292

câu hỏi đã được viết

Bắt đầu phát triển web tương tác đúng cách

Tìm hiểu về các sự kiện nhấp chuột với các ví dụ về ký tự chuyển động

선생님 css background에 대한 질문입니다.

Đã giải quyết

Viết

·

276

0

선생님 움직이는 이벤트 예제에서요

image를 삽입할때 img src tag를 사용하지 않고 

css에서 

background-image: url();

을 사용하는 걸까요??

인터랙티브-웹javascriptHTML/CSS

Câu trả lời 3

1

studiomeal님의 프로필 이미지
studiomeal
Người chia sẻ kiến thức

아- 실수로 그러신거라면 다행입니다^^ 저는 강의에서 뭔가 부족한게 있었나 생각했어요~ㅎㅎ
(수강평은 수정하실 때 별 부분을 클릭하면 별점도 수정이 되거든요~ 혹시 시간 되실때 수정해주실 수 있으면 수정 부탁드릴게요 하핫^^;)

1

studiomeal님의 프로필 이미지
studiomeal
Người chia sẻ kiến thức

CSS 백그라운드로 넣으면 해당 클래스의 CSS만 수정하면 이미지를 바꿀 수 있는 점이 좋고,
이미지의 크기 조정이 아주 수월해지기때문에 백그라운드 이미지를 자주 사용해요.
background-size: cover나 background-size: contain같은 동작을 img 태그를 이용해 만들려고 하면 아주 귀찮은 작업을 해야하거든요~
그렇다고 언제나 백그라운드 이미지를 사용하는 것은 아니고요, 내용상 중요한 이미지라면 img 태그로 넣어주시고, 장식적인 요소라면 백그라운드 이미지로 해주시고. 그렇게 해주시면 좋습니다.
아니면 아래처럼 둘 다 적용 후에, CSS로 img는 display: none 처리 해서 안보이게 하는 방법도 있고요^^
html <figure class="my-image" style="background-image: ..."><img src="..."></figure>
css .my-image img { display: none; }

(아참 ss S님, 강의 수강평 내용은 아주 좋게 써주셨는데..별점을 2개를 주셨더라고요^^;; 혹시 강의에 부족한 점 느끼신게 있을까요? 알려주시면 다음 강의를 만들 때 개선할 수 있는 점이라면 개선 해보도록 하려고요^^)

0

ss S님의 프로필 이미지
ss S
Người đặt câu hỏi

선생님 답변 감사합니다. 
저는 background는 노란색 배경인데 왜 image를 넣으면서 그게 background가 되는가하고 생각했어요. css로 image를 control하면 장점이 있다로 이해하고 좀 더 공부를 열심히 해봐야 겠습니다. 
그리고 선생님 강의 덕분에 정말 재밌게 공부 잘 하고 있는데 제가 별점을 왜 그렇게 했는지 도무지 기억이 나질 않습니다ㅠ 지금도 별 100개 드리려고 한참을 찾아봤는데 어디서 제가 그 짓을 한 것인지 도저히 못 찾겠어요 죄송합니다

Hình ảnh hồ sơ của sss9524560292
sss9524560292

câu hỏi đã được viết

Đặt câu hỏi